    Places to eat:

    CBD Provisions (in the Joule)

    Dallas Chop House

    Stampede 66

    St. Anne's (great patio)

    Lark on the Park

    Meso Maya (mexican)

    Capital Grille ($$&dollarSmiley winking

    Javiers (mexican - a little farther away but really good)

    Taverna (Italian)

    Si Tapas (spanish tapas and great drinks)

    Smoke (Nice Barbecue)

    Places to brunch:

    Taverna

    The Rustic (more casual)

    Company Cafe (more casual, all organic)

    St. Anne's

    Jonathan's (a bit of a trek, but in an awesome area of Dallas and amazing food)

    Places to go out:

    Thursday -

    The Standard Pour

    Social House

    The Rattlesnake (in the Ritz)

    Hotel ZaZa pool

    The Loon

    Billy Bobs

    Friday/Saturday:

    Same places as above plus

    Three Sheets (uptown)

    The Dram

    Prime Bar

    Quarter Bar

    For my bach we went went to dinner at the Meddlesome Moth in the design district and then to Pete's Dueling Pianos up in Addison. I live in Deep Ellum and that's really fun too, great food, quirky bars (I personally love On Premise, they serve some awesome food) and music venues, there is also a piano bar. I'd stay away from downtown. Uptown has awesome food, bars, and a clubs. King Spa is awesome (check groupon if you decide to go) if you want to spend all day relaxing.
